Chapter 69: Chapter 69: Data War

The giant wolf that was Shen Feng’s consciousness and the giant bird that was Jingwei charged forward through the black void, ducking into the "Space Wormhole."

A silken thread trailed behind each of them, connecting back to their point of origin.

Transmission in the digital world occurs at near-light speed. An instant later, they materialized in a new location, faced with a black concrete wall.

The wall’s length and width were impossible to determine; it stretched infinitely in every direction, appearing to completely block off the digital void they occupied.

"This is Poseidon’s outer firewall. Let’s tear it down together!" Jingwei cried out, extending its talons toward the black, eternal wall. It instantly ripped away a large chunk of rubble, revealing a patch of pixels beneath.

Shen Feng, too, began swiping with his claws, tearing into the firewall.

Yet, every time they tore a piece away, the firewall immediately repaired itself.

Jingwei snorted. Its body suddenly twisted and deformed, transforming in the blink of an eye into a tunnel boring machine. With its drill spinning, it began to bore its way inward.

Shen Feng understood that everything before his eyes was merely a visual representation. In reality, Jingwei was likely acting like a virus program, relentlessly attacking the enemy’s firewall until it could breach it completely.

Seeing this, he quickly shifted from his giant wolf form into that of a man wielding a giant axe. He followed closely behind Jingwei, breaking down the wall as he moved forward.

Since this was his first time entering the digital world purely as a conscious projection, his offensive capabilities were still quite limited; he could only rely on brute force for destructive attacks.

Against the outer firewall, however, that was enough.

Jingwei was clearly more adept at this. In less than ten seconds, they had penetrated the outer firewall and entered the area enclosed by the high wall.

Inside was a vast ocean with no end in sight. The only other feature was the firewall behind them—a large hole bored through its center—stretching out to either side until it disappeared over the horizon.

Shen Feng let out an involuntary whistle.

’The sheer volume of data here is incredible.’

Every drop of water in this ocean contained endless amounts of data, all of it from various information stockpiles compiled before the war.

Apparently, the Eagle Country’s nuclear strike system was perfectly preserved and also retained massive amounts of pre-war data.

’But where exactly is "Poseidon," the artificial intelligence presiding over all this?’

The conscious projections of Shen Feng and Jingwei now stood on the surface of the ocean, looking around for Poseidon.

The vast ocean before them suddenly began to boil, and moments later, towering waves surged, creating a massive tsunami.

Shen Feng and Jingwei scrambled onto the firewall, dodging the impact.

At the same time, a colossal, thousand-meter-tall figure slowly emerged from the seabed. It wielded a giant trident, looking down on the axeman and the bird, Jingwei.

It had a curly, salt-and-pepper beard, a bare torso, and wore a garment in the style of ancient Greece. Its entire body was muscled with the beautiful, fluid lines of a sculpture.

It was the controller of the Trident and Minuteman missiles, the very embodiment of the North American nuclear strike system: Poseidon!

"JINGWEI—" Poseidon roared. With a flick of his hand, waves lifted from the sea, transforming in mid-air into a volley of tridents that blotted out the sky as they shot toward Shen Feng and Jingwei.

These tridents were all destructive programs, aimed directly at the core consciousness of Jingwei and Shen Feng.

Jingwei spread its wings, instantly firing off a dense volley of feathers that formed a round shield in front of them, blocking the tridents.

This was its defense program.

Shen Feng’s consciousness also shifted rapidly, and he once again became a giant wolf, pouncing toward Poseidon.

The trident-shaped destruction programs landed on the giant wolf’s body, making a pleasant, chiming sound—CLINK! CLANG!—as they were all deflected aside.

The giant wolf’s body was made of transparent crystal, making it incredibly difficult to destroy.

This was, in fact, a form of mirrored protection that Shen Feng had created by referencing Jingwei.

In the blink of an eye, the giant wolf was in front of Poseidon. It leaped up, lunging for Poseidon’s throat and chest.

That was generally where an AI’s core code was located. Destroy the core code, and he could annihilate Poseidon.

Just then, the ocean abruptly froze over. An instant later, thick, mountain-sized spikes of ice erupted from the surface, stabbing at the crystal wolf in the air.

The vast stores of past information could also be used as a powerful weapon. If one of those spikes pierced a target’s conscious projection, the sheer volume of data would cause it to overload and rupture.

"Shen Feng!" Jingwei shouted, its wings beating to stir up a gale.

The gale transformed in mid-air into a swarm of crimson Eastern dragons that instantly melted the ice pillars.

This was one of Jingwei’s subroutines: the control program for the Dongfeng strategic nuclear missiles.

Poseidon snorted and slammed his giant trident onto the frozen sea. Instantly, dozens of icemen wielding tridents emerged and clashed with the crimson dragons.

Meanwhile, the giant wolf that was Shen Feng reached Poseidon. Still in mid-air, it transformed again, this time into a young man with a giant axe, who brought it down on Poseidon from above.

Poseidon quickly raised his trident to block the axe, forcing Shen Feng back.

The battle raged on for what felt like over half an hour. Both sides had sustained damage, but neither could land a fatal blow.

With a solemn expression, Shen Feng snapped his fingers. In the next instant, plumes of black smoke billowed from his body, quickly forming several dozen ferocious-looking monsters in front of him.

There were one-horned lizards, spiny octopuses, and unidentifiable black shadows, to name a few. They all let out a roar and lunged at Poseidon.

These things were all legitimate viruses, originating from data he had copied from his own computer—especially from the "Research Materials" folder!

Compared to the kilometer-tall Poseidon, these ten- and twenty-meter-tall virus-monsters were insignificant. Their advantage, however, was their sheer number. They swarmed Poseidon’s body like locusts and began to tear and bite.

Meanwhile, Shen Feng and Jingwei joined forces and, in a flash, had dispatched the icemen subroutines.

The crimson dragons circled Poseidon, spitting fire and creating a wall of flames.

Shen Feng leaped directly onto Jingwei’s back. Man and bird soared into the air, diving toward Poseidon.

Shen Feng stood on the bird’s back, axe held in both hands, ready to deliver the killing blow to Poseidon at a moment’s notice.

Just then, a cryptic smile appeared on Poseidon’s face.

In the next instant, the clouds obscuring half the sky suddenly froze over. Below, spikes of ice shot up from the sea of data, connecting with the frozen clouds like the bars of a fence. In the blink of an eye, they had formed a cage of redundant data, trapping both Shen Feng and Jingwei inside.

The volume of data was immense, more than enough to completely bury Shen Feng and Jingwei.

"Two arrogant fools, trying to challenge me in the world of data. You truly don’t know your own limits," Poseidon said with a cold expression, crushing the last virus monster in his hand.

Just then, Shen Feng let out a sly chuckle and quickly recited, "252.13870514843748, 39.83643042174908; 286.41604889843745, 37.64299573536318; 274.46292389843745, 53.48350787766046..."

In a flash, he had spoken five sets of coordinates before he stopped. By then, Poseidon’s face was ashen, its body trembling.

"You..."

Before it could finish speaking, its entire body began to shake violently, turning slightly transparent as if it had suffered a massive blow.

"How about that? I sent my last few remaining nukes your way. So? Did you enjoy it? Did you?" Jingwei asked with a curious expression.

The coordinates Shen Feng had recited were the real-world locations of the core servers where Poseidon’s consciousness resided!

And just moments ago, three of those five core server locations had been struck by Dongfeng strategic nuclear missiles, which had bored through their protective shells.
